Thursday 2 May 2013
npower League 2
Bradford City 2 (Wells 37, Thompson 74)
Burton Albion 3 (Zola 22, 28, Weir 44)
Kick Off: 7.45pm
at the Coral Windows Stadium

Attendance: 14,657 (656 visitors)

The Bantams have some work to do if they want to book a second visit to Wembley of the season after suffering a home defeat at the hands of Burton Albion in their League 2 Play-Off First Leg encounter.


Phil Parkinson's men found themselves two goals down within the first half hour of the match thanks to two well-taken goals from Calvin Zola before Nahki Wells reduced City's deficit near the end of the first period from the penalty spot.


There was still time in the half, however, for Robbie Weir to establish Burton's two-goal lead once more just before the break with a great finish inside the area from Alex MacDonald's low cross.


After a relatively quiet opening period by their standards, City dug in during the second half and twice could have netted a second in the game through Wells.


The Bantams did eventually get a goal back sixteen minutes from the end when Garry Thompson crashed in an unstoppable shot from outside the area.


Despite six minutes of injury time, City couldn't quite drag themselves back on level terms but Thompson's late thunderbolt still could prove vital when the sides meet again this Sunday for the second leg.


With large parts of the Coral Windows Stadium packed to the rafters by kick off, City were met by a wall of noise as they entered the field to begin their Play-Off adventure.


City were unable to get the early foothold in the match they would undoubtedly have been hoping for, however, and they were hit with the blow of conceding first.


Twenty-two minutes were just about on the clock when Zola was on hand to head home Jacques Maghoma's teasing left wing cross.


Stunned from Zola's opening blow, City fell further behind six minutes later when the giant striker turned away from Rory McArdle inside the area before finishing expertly with a fine angled drive into the far corner of Jon McLaughlin's goal.


Replays seem to suggest that Zola was clearly offside following Zander Diamond's ball forward to the striker but there was no doubting the quality of the finish.


Importantly for City though, Parkinson's side didn't take too long to respond as they were awarded a penalty when Damien McCrory handled a goal-bound strike from Thompson inside the area eight minutes before the break.


McCrory seemed to throw his arms at the ball to deliberately block the shot but to the amazement of the City camp, the defender wasn't even shown a yellow card for the offence.


Wells coolly slotted the resulting penalty away to fire the Bantams back in it but Burton weren't finished either unfortunately as Weir fired in the visitors' third of the night on the stroke of half time.


Weir was teed up by a low cross from MacDonald from the byline and the midfielder completed the move with a fierce drive that beat McLaughlin at his near post.



Clearly in need to chase the game after the restart, Parkinson brought on Kyel Reid and Nathan Doyle early into the second period in an attempt to change his side's fortunes.


Wells enjoyed a great chance to pull a goal back for City just past the hour mark when he latched onto Diamond's poor attempted header back towards Stuart Tomlinson.


The Bermudian's connection when through on goal wasn't clear though and the 'keeper could block the effort away.


Wells found himself on the end of another promising opening ten minutes later but this time he could only scuff a first time effort wide from inside the six yard box after finding himself unmarked at the far post following a Gary Jones corner.


Just two minutes later, however, City were back in it when Thompson let rip with a thunderous drive from just outside the area that flew past the helpless Thompson before crashing into the net behind him.


City nearly had the wind taken out of their sails when MacDonald clipped the top of McLaughlin's crossbar shortly after Thompson's stunner, but the final plays of the game were all about whether the Bantams could complete the comeback and get the tie back all-square.


The Bantams' best chance to do that came in the third minute of injury time when James Meredith's low cross found Hanson in the box but the striker dragged a shot wide of goal.


MATCH UPDATES:

FT: Bradford City 2 Burton Albion 3

90+3min: Meredith's low cross into the area eventually finds Hanson over by the far post but his scuffed effort from around eight yards out bounces harmlessly wide.

90min: There will be six minutes of time added on at the end of the first leg.

89min: SUB - The Brewers bring on Adam Drury for MacDonald.

89min: SUB - The Bantams bring on Alan Connell for Wells.

87min: Nelson heads a few yards over the bar following Jones' free-kick into the area from a wide position.

85min: YELLOW CARD - MacDonald is booked for a late tackle on Reid over by the touchline on City's left flank.

79min: YELLOW CARD - Tomlinson is booked for delaying play restarting after Burton are awarded a free-kick inside City's half. Tomlinson, the only player inside Burton's half of the pitch, simply stands there and refuses to kick the ball up to the part of the pitch where the free-kick is going to be taken from. 

78min: Wells fizzes in a 25 yard free-kick that flies a couple of yards over Tomlinson's goal.

77min: CHANCE - Maghoma's low centre across goal eventually finds MacDonald over on the far side of the area. The attacker takes aim from around fourteen yards out before firing a rising drive that clips the top of McLaughlin's bar.

76min: Wells curls an effort for goal from the edge of the area that the back-tracking Tomlinson keeps out before just about preventing the ball from crossing the line as well.

74min: GOAL!!!!! Bradford City 2 Burton Albion 3 - The Bantams are back in it again! Thompson lets rip with a stunning strike from around 20 yards out that whistles past Tomlinson's dive before crashing into the roof of the net.

72min: CHANCE! Wells misses a promising opportunity when Jones' delivery from the resulting corner eventually falls into his path inside the six yard box. Turning on the ball, Wells shoots almost instantly but his effort is sliced and flies horribly wide.

71min: Wells sees his effort for goal from around eight yards out is blocked behind by Holness following Thompson low cross to the near post from the byline.

69min: Doyle takes aim from distance but his effort is wild and flies into the Kop.

68min: SUB - Burton bring on Billy Kee for Zola.

63min: CHANCE! - Wells latches onto a poor attempted header back to Tomlinson from Zander Diamond to see the Bermudian beat the 'keeper to the loose ball and place himself through on goal. Wells tries to knock the ball between Tomlinson's legs but the 'keeper makes a vital block. Thompson fires the loose ball back into the mix with a cross-come-shot that just evades the outstretched leg of Wells in the middle and flashes a yard or so wide of the far post.

62min: Maghoma tumbles in the box under pressure from McArdle but referee Mr James Adcock waves away Burton's shouts for a penalty.

58min: McLaughlin has to spring across low to left to prevent a drive from just outside the area from McGrath from sneaking in.

57min: SUBS - The Bantams bring on Kyel Reid and Nathan Doyle for Atkinson and Ricky Ravenhill respectively.

50min: Atkinson is back on the pitch now complete with his new numberless 'blood' shirt.

50min: Zola jumps above Stephen Darby and McArdle to reach MacDonald's far post cross but his header flies a couple of yards wide.

47min: City currently down to ten men with Atkinson off the pitch as he receives treatment for a bloody nose.

46min: The Bantams restart the match.

HT: Bradford City 1 Burton Albion 3

45+3min: Maghoma fires a low drive from distance a yard or so wide of goal.

45+2min: After wrestling for possession of the ball by the byline with Holness, Wells produces a smart bicycle cross that actually ends not too far away from bouncing in over by Tomlinson's far post.

45min: There will be three minutes of time added on at the end of the first half.

44min: GOAL - Bradford City 1 Burton Albion 3 - City have it all to do again unfortunately as Alex MacDonald's low cross to the neat post is slammed home from around ten yards out by Robbie Weir.

40min: On the stretch trying to reach Hanson,s lay-off, Jones can only fire wide with a rising drive from around 20 or so yards out.

37min: GOAL!!!!! - Bradford City 1 Burton Albion 2 - The Bantams are back in as Wells coolly slots the ball into the corner!

36min: PENALTY TO THE BANTAMS! - City have a spot-kick when Damien McCrory is adjudged to have blocked a Thompson shot with his hand in the area. Hanson's neat lay-off to McArdle inside the area starts the ball rolling as he finds the defender in plenty of shooting space. The defender unfortunately produces an air kick but Thompson is on hand to pounce on the loose ball and produce the shot that McCrory would handle.

35min: YELLOW CARD - Marcus Holness is booked for taking out Thompson out on City's right flank.

34min: CHANCE - McLaughlin makes a great block to prevent City going further behind. A great ball through from Robbie Weir plays McGrath in with a clear sight on goal but McLaughlin makes himself big to produce a vital save.

33min: A sliced attempted clearance by John McGrath sees the ball fall back into his area following a Thompson long throw. Nahki Wells stretches to reach the ball but his flicked effort for goal rolls wide. 

31min: McArdle connects with another wide Jones free-kick into the area but his free header is blocked away.

28min: GOAL - Bradford City 0 Burton Albion 2 - Some trouble for City here now as Zola grabs his second of the game. The giant striker turns away from McArdle in the area before curling a delightful effort into the far corner of McLaughlin's net. There appears to be some suggestion that Zola was offside when he originally received the ball but their is not disputing the quality of the finish.

27min: Rory McArdle heads a good few yards over the bar after meeting with a wide Gary Jones free-kick floated into the area.

23min: A long kick forward from Tomlinson eventually falls into the path of MacDonald around the edge of City's area. The attacker stoops to header the ball goalwards but his effort is tame and straight at McLaughlin.

22min: GOAL - Bradford City 0 Burton Albion 1 - City are stunned as Burton take the lead. Jacques Maghoma sends over a cross from Burton left flank and Zola is on hand to head home.

18min: With a yard or so of shooting space available to him, Zola turns on the ball around 25 yards out and fires forward but his effort is well wayward and sails into the packed Kop behind McLaughlin's net.

12min: James Hanson beats Anthony O'Connor in the air just outside Burton's penalty area to flick the ball forward but Will Atkinson's first time effort on the volley from the edge of the box rolls harmlessly wide of Stuart Tomlinson's near post.

9min: Calvin Zola beats Michael Nelson in the air to flick the ball into the path of Alex MacDonald but the attacker, who has James Meredith and Rory McArdle putting him under pressure, can only fire weakly at Jon McLaughlin from the edge of the area.

6min: Garry Thompson cuts inside from a wide position and away from the attentions of Damien McCrory but his rising angled drive from inside the area is headed up and out for a corner by Burton defender Ian Sharps.

0min: Burton kick off the match. City will attack towards the T.L Dallas Stand end in the first half.

7:46pm: The Coral Windows Stadium is literally rocking as the game is set to get underway.


BRADFORD CITY LINE UP
McLaughlin, Darby, Nelson, McArdle, Meredith, Thompson, Ravenhill, Jones, Atkinson, Wells, Hanson
Subs: Duke, Reid, Gray, McHugh, Connell, Hines, Doyle

Bradford changes:
Reid for Atkinson (57), Doyle for Ravenhill (57), Connell for Wells (89)

Bradford cautions:

Bradford dismissals:

BURTON ALBION LINE UP
Tomlinson, O'Connor, Holness, Diamond, Sharps, McCrory, MacDonald, Weir, McGrath, Maghoma, Zola
Subs: Lyness, Webster, Phillips, Paterson, Drury, Kee, Symes

Burton changes:
Kee for Zola (68), Drury for MacDonald (89)

Burton cautions:
Holness (35), Tomlinson (79), MacDonald (85)

Burton dismissals:

MATCH OFFICIALS:
Referee: James Adcock
Assistant Referee: Ian Hussin
Assistant Referee: Keith Lawson
Fourth Official: Andy Haines
